Abstract

The utility model provides a rock plate table top frame, and belongs to the technical field of table top frames. A rock plate table top frame comprises a bottom plate, a gear, adjusting rods, moving rods and a telescopic mechanism, the adjusting rods comprise the first adjusting rod and the second adjusting rod, and the moving rods comprise the first moving rod and the second moving rod; the gear is fixedly installed in the center of the bottom plate, one side of the gear is connected with the first adjusting rod, and the other side of the gear is connected with the second adjusting rod. A plurality of gear teeth are arranged on the side faces, close to the gear, of the first adjusting rod and the second adjusting rod and meshed with the gear. The end, away from the gear, of the first adjusting rod is fixedly connected with a first moving rod. The end, away from the gear, of the second adjusting rod is fixedly connected with a second moving rod. The two ends of the moving rod are connected with clamps through connecting pieces, and the clamps sleeve the two ends of the telescopic mechanism. The utility model provides a rock plate table top frame which aims to solve the problems that an existing table top frame cannot stretch out and draw back according to the size of a rock plate, and space utilization is not flexible enough.

[0001] The utility model belongs to the technical field of desktop frames, and specifically relates to a rock slab desktop frame. Background Art

[0002] The desktop frame is a frame used to support the installation of the desktop panel. The traditional rock slab desktop frame design usually adopts a fixed-size structure. A desktop frame can only fit a fixed-size rock slab. This design limits the size of the rock slab. The desktop frame is difficult to adapt to rock slabs of different sizes, and the space utilization is not flexible enough and cannot be adjusted according to needs. Utility Model Content

[0003] In order to solve the deficiencies in the prior art, the utility model provides a rock slab desktop frame to solve the problem that the existing desktop frame cannot be expanded or contracted according to the size of the rock slab and the space utilization is not flexible enough.

[0004] The utility model adopts the following technical solutions.

[0005] A rock slab desktop frame includes a base plate, a gear, an adjustment rod, a movable rod, and a telescopic mechanism, wherein the adjustment rod includes a first adjustment rod and a second adjustment rod, and the movable rod includes a first movable rod and a second movable rod; a gear is fixedly mounted at the center of the base plate, one side of the gear is connected to the first adjustment rod, and the other side of the gear is connected to the second adjustment rod; a plurality of gear teeth are provided on the side of the first adjustment rod and the second adjustment rod close to the gear, and the gear teeth are meshed with the gears;

[0006] One end of the first adjusting rod away from the gear is fixedly connected to the first moving rod, and one end of the second adjusting rod away from the gear is fixedly connected to the second moving rod; both ends of the moving rod are connected to the clamp through a connecting piece, and the clamp is sleeved on both ends of the telescopic mechanism.

[0007] Furthermore, the number of the telescopic mechanisms is two, and the two telescopic mechanisms are arranged on both sides of the bottom plate, and the two telescopic mechanisms are parallel to the adjustment rod;

[0008] Each telescopic mechanism comprises a telescopic shell and a telescopic rod, and two telescopic rods are arranged in the telescopic shell.

[0009] Furthermore, the telescopic rod is a hollow I-shaped structure, and a sliding groove is provided in the middle of the upper and lower ends of the telescopic rod. The upper and lower side walls of the telescopic shell are correspondingly provided with sliding protrusions. The sliding groove cooperates with the sliding protrusions to enable the two telescopic rods to move in opposite directions within the telescopic shell.

[0010] Furthermore, the telescopic shell is provided with a plurality of bolt holes, and the telescopic rod is provided with a plurality of mounting holes. The bolt holes and the mounting holes have the same size. The bolts pass through the bolt holes and the mounting holes to fix the telescopic rod and the telescopic shell.

[0011] Furthermore, the clamp is sleeved on the end of the telescopic rod away from the telescopic shell, the interior of the clamp is hollow and adapts to the outer contour of the telescopic rod; one side of the clamp is fixedly connected to the connecting piece, and the other side surface is provided with a hole of the same size as the mounting hole, and the clamp is fixed to the telescopic rod by bolts.

[0012] Furthermore, the bottom of the clamp is fixedly connected to a connecting plate, and the connecting plate is an L-shaped structure.

[0013] Furthermore, when multiple rock slab desktop frames are connected, an adapter plate is provided on the connecting plate, and the connecting plate is fixedly connected to the adapter plate.

[0014] Furthermore, a limiting plate is provided at one end of the first adjusting rod and the second adjusting rod close to the gear to limit the rotation distance of the first adjusting rod and the second adjusting rod on the gear.

[0015] Furthermore, a scale is provided on the adjusting rod, and a starting point of the scale is an end of the adjusting rod close to the moving rod.

[0016] The beneficial effect of the present invention is that, compared with the prior art, the rock slab desktop frame provided by the present invention can be extended and retracted according to the size of the rock slab, thereby improving the applicability of the desktop frame. By setting up a telescopic mechanism, the rock slab desktop frame can be extended and retracted to the desired size, and the telescopic shell and telescopic rod are fixed by bolts. By setting up the gears, moving rods and adjusting rods, the stretching of the rock slab desktop frame is more labor-saving and smoother, and the setting of the scale on the adjusting rod allows the user to quickly and accurately stretch it to the desired size. By setting up a connecting plate, the two rock slab desktop frames are connected together through an adapter plate, thereby improving space utilization. BRIEF DESCRIPTION OF THE DRAWINGS

[0025] As shown in Figure 1-2 A rock plate table top frame, including bottom plate 1, gear 2, adjusting rod 3, moving rod 4 and telescopic mechanism 6, adjusting rod 3 includes first adjusting rod 31 and second adjusting rod 32, moving rod 4 includes first moving rod 41 and second moving rod 42.

[0026] As shown in Figure 1-2 Gear 2 is fixedly installed at the center of bottom plate 1, one side of gear 2 is connected with first adjusting rod 31, and the other side of gear 2 is connected with second adjusting rod 32. First adjusting rod 31 and second adjusting rod 32 are provided with a plurality of gear teeth on the side face close to gear 2, and the gear teeth are engaged with gear 2. First adjusting rod 31 and second adjusting rod 32 are provided with limiting plate 7 at one end close to gear 2, limiting the rotating distance of first adjusting rod 31 and second adjusting rod 32 on gear 2, and the other end of first adjusting rod 31 away from gear 2 is fixedly connected with first moving rod 41, and the other end of second adjusting rod 32 away from gear 2 is fixedly connected with second moving rod 42. Both ends of moving rod 4 are connected with clamp 5 through connecting piece 9, and clamp 5 is sleeved on both ends of telescopic mechanism 6. For the installation of gear 2 and bottom plate 1, bearing can be used for fixation, the rotating shaft of gear 2 is sleeved with the inner ring of bearing, the outer ring of bearing is put into the groove of bearing seat, so that the cooperation between bearing and bearing seat is tight, and the bearing seat is connected with bottom plate 1 through bolts or other fasteners.

[0027] The adjusting rod 3 is provided with a scale, the starting point of the scale is the end of the adjusting rod 3 close to the moving rod 4, and the setting of the scale can more clearly express the extended distance.

[0028] As shown in Figure 3As shown, there are two sets of telescopic mechanisms 6, which are arranged on either side of the base plate 1 and parallel to the adjustment rod 3. Each set of telescopic mechanisms 6 includes a telescopic housing 61 and a telescopic rod 62. The telescopic housing 61 houses two telescopic rods 62, each of which is a hollow I-shaped structure. Slide grooves are provided between the upper and lower ends of the telescopic rods 62. The upper and lower side walls of the telescopic housing 61 are provided with corresponding sliding protrusions. The slide grooves cooperate with the sliding protrusions to enable the two telescopic rods 62 to move in opposite directions within the telescopic housing 61. The telescopic housing 61 is provided with several bolt holes, and the telescopic rods 62 are provided with several mounting holes. The bolt holes and mounting holes are the same size. Bolts pass through the bolt holes and mounting holes to secure the telescopic rods 62 to the telescopic housing 61.

[0029] like Figure 4-5 As shown, the interior of the clamp 5 is hollow and conforms to the outer contour of the telescopic rod 62. One side of the clamp 5 is fixedly connected to the connector 9. The other side has a hole of the same size as the mounting hole. The clamp 5 is fixed to the end of the telescopic rod 62 away from the telescopic housing 61 by bolts. The bottom of the clamp 5 is provided with a connecting plate 8, which is an L-shaped structure and is fixedly connected to the clamp 5.

[0030] like Figure 6 As shown, in scenarios where two tables need to be spliced ​​together in an environment with limited space, or an office environment that requires collaboration among multiple people, the adapter plate 10 is placed on the connecting plate 8 on one side of the two rock slab desktop frames and fixedly connected by fasteners such as bolts. When the two rock slab desktop frames are placed vertically, the adapter plate 10 can be set to a fan shape. When two or more rock slab desktop frames are set along the extension direction of the moving rod, the adapter plate 10 can be set to a rectangle.

[0031] The two slate tabletop frames are connected via the adapter plate 10 and the connecting plate 8, making full use of space resources and allowing for flexible layouts according to different scenarios. In an office environment requiring multi-person collaboration, connecting the two tables via the connecting plate 10 facilitates communication and collaboration between employees. In places such as exhibition areas or living rooms, the two tables connected by the connecting plate 10 can serve as decoration, adding a sense of hierarchy to the space.

[0032] Working principle:

[0033] According to the different sizes of rock slabs, the distance to be extended is calculated. The user only needs to pull out the first moving rod or the second moving rod by hand. The gear teeth on the first adjusting rod or the second adjusting rod engage with the gear, driving the gear to rotate, thereby driving the second adjusting rod or the first adjusting rod to move in the opposite direction. At the same time, the telescopic rod is extended in the direction away from the telescopic shell through the sliding protrusion; observe the scale on the moving rod, and when it moves to the required length, fix the telescopic shell and the telescopic rod with bolts, and then place the rock slab on the desktop frame. The bottom of the base plate can be fixedly connected to the table legs.
